Marika, with professional and educational background in the US, graduated with a 5-year Bachelor of Architecture degree from the University of Philadelphia with a minor degree in Landscape Architecture. Her graduating thesis project on “Housing Informality” was nominated to represent the University at the Archiprix International Competition, among the world’s best architectural student work. After gaining professional experience in the US, Marika received a Master’s in Architectural Management and Design from the IE Business School in Madrid, Spain.
Marika has worked at HDR Inc for three years and her experience varies from large-scale projects in regions such as UAE, China, US to mixed-use buildings, offices, academic and health care facilities including a patient center for the University of Pennsylvania in a direct partnership between HDR and Foster + Partners.
In addition to her practice, she served the Association of Young Professionals of HDR in the US through the elected positions of VP and President. Her leading role focused on skills and career development as well as maintaining a strong office culture.
